About Dumri Khurd Village
Dumri Khurd is a large village in Majorganj tehsil, in the district of Sitamarhi, Bihar.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 4,367, made up of 2,258 males and 2,109 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 934 females per 1000 males. The village covers 133.4 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 843315,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Dumri Khurd
The census records public bus service for Dumri Khurd as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
